2010/09/08 Monday (NEX)
Experiment:Digestion of bcsA,B,C
- Member
- bambi75 and NEX
- Material
- bcsA,B,C
- 10×Mbuffer
- BSA
- XbaI
- SpeI
- Procedure
- Add "material" to PCR tubes(show below)
- Incubation at (37℃,7h)
composition bcsA bcsB bcsC solution of bcs(μl) 60 60 60 10×Mbuffer(μl) 6 6 6 BSA(μl) 2 2 XbaI(μl) 1.2 1.2 SpeI(ul) 1.2 1.2
Preparation:Make Agarose Gels Electro-phoresis
- Member
- Same above
- Materials
- 1×TaE 200ml
- Agarose 2g
- Ethidium bromide 10µl
- Procedure
- Add and mixture above materials in an Erlenmeyer flask
- Warm up them in a Microwave oven
